How long is the flight from TIA to CLJ?
Great-circle distance is 676 km. With typical jet cruise speed plus taxi, climb and descent, expect roughly 78–88 min gate-to-gate on this route.
How often does TIA–CLJ fly?
TAROM-ROMANIAN AIR TRANSPORT runs the route with about 1 flight a week (wed). Since one carrier owns the route, a single disruption tends to ripple through the day.
What does the route health score measure?
A blend of departure-side delay at TIA and arrival-side delay at CLJ, computed from rolling delay windows (refreshed every 40 minutes) with a daily-rollup fallback. Current MVFR, IFR, or LIFR endpoint weather caps the score when flight rules can limit throughput. Higher is healthier: 100 means operations are clean at both ends.
